Walgreens
25 mile radius of Orchard Park, NY
2/22/2025
Depew, NY, US
Williamsville, NY, US
Hamburg, NY, US
North Tonawanda, NY, US
Buffalo, NY, US
North Tonawanda, NY, US
North Tonawanda, NY, US
Cheektowaga, NY, US
Tonawanda, NY, US
Amherst, NY, US